# Break-Glass: Catalog Cache Invalidation

Scope: the Pinrow product catalog at Veldstone Retail. If stale prices persist after a purge and the Hollowmere invalidation queue is wedged, use break-glass to flush the edge tier directly. Contractors: get verbal sign-off from the catalog lead first. Steps: open the Hollowmere admin shell, select emergency-flush, confirm the tenant, and run it once — repeated flushes thrash the origin. Access is logged and expires after 20 minutes. Unseal the admin shell with the passphrase below.

recovery phrase for kahop-tajog: istix-casvan

## Deployment

The Crashline pipeline ingests crash reports from the Fernwick mobile apps and fans them out to plugin workers. Plugin authors deploy against the staging collector first; production promotion happens after symbolication checks pass. Each worker reads its settings at startup and does not hot-reload. The values your plugin will see in the standard environment are shown below.

settings of faweg-tahop:
ISTAX_PIN=8134
ISTAX_METRICS_HOST=metrics.istax.tolvaqcorp.internal
ISTAX_LOG_LEVEL=debug
ISTAX_TENANT=caseth

Ticket #- Kiosk watchdog locked the vault again

Hey, the Burrowlane kiosk watchdog rebooted mid-update and now the local secrets vault is sealed, so the kiosk app just loops on the splash screen. Happens whenever the watchdog fires during a write. Plug in at the service panel, open the recovery prompt, and unseal with the passphrase below.

vault phrase of kafog-kahif = holdor-rusir-praox

**Ticket: Config drift on nightly search reindex (Marblehut cluster)**

Heads up — the reindex job on Marblehut has drifted from what's in source control. Someone hand-tweaked the batch size and shard timeout back in spring and it never got committed, so the nightly run behaves differently than staging. Nothing looks malicious, but please eyeball it anyway. Here's what the box is actually running with right now.

deployment values, yadug-bawif:
[framir]
team = pelox
access_code = ac_a38ab2
owner = tamion.julael
host = framir.tolvaqlabs.test
port = 11211
peer = tammir.zemvargrid.local
salt = 2215ef03
pin = 1541